What is Saint Michael?
Saint Michael, officially Saint Michael the Archangel Catholic High School, is an accredited Catholic institution established in 2004 in Fredericksburg, Virginia. The school is dedicated to providing a rigorous college preparatory curriculum, enriched with dual enrollment and honors classes, emphasizing personalized student attention. Its core mission revolves around fostering the holistic development of students—academically, spiritually, morally, artistically, and athletically—while upholding the dignity of each individual. The school serves families seeking a supportive, challenging, and faith-centered educational environment.
